Westermeyer name meaning and origin

The family name Westermeyer is of German origin and means "western farmer" or "farmer from the west." It likely originated as an occupational surname for someone who was a farmer living in the western part of a region or country. This surname could also have roots in other languages and regions, but the most common meaning is tied to its German origin.

History of family crests like the Westermeyer coat of arms

Family crests and coats of arms emerged during the Middle Ages, mostly in wider Europe. They were used as a way to identify knights and nobles on the battlefield and in tournaments. The designs were unique to each family and were passed down from generation to generation.

The earliest crests were simple designs, such as a single animal or symbol, but they became more elaborate over time. Coats of arms were also developed, which included a shield with the family crest, as well as other symbols and colors that represented the family's history and achievements.

The use of family crests and coats of arms spread throughout Europe and became a symbol of social status and identity. They were often displayed on clothing, armor, and flags, and were used to mark the family's property and possessions.

Today, family crests and coats of arms are still used as a way to honor and celebrate family heritage.
